The Houston Metropolitan Area consists of eight counties in Texas.
The Houston-Galveston-Brazoria CMSA has approximately 4,669,571 people. It covers an area slightly smaller than Massachusetts but slightly larger than New Jersey.

Description of Economic Activity

The area's economic activity is mostly in the
Harris County seat, Houston, Texas. Houston is a major port and financial center for oil companies.

Baytown also has a port, as is Galveston. Galveston also has a cruise ship terminal and is a recreational area for people in the region. Sugar Land holds the Imperial Sugar headquarters. Their main sugar factory was once in that city, but it closed down.

Texas' second largest airport, George Bush Intercontinental Airport, is located in the north area of the city of Houston. Continental Airlines is headquartered in downtown Houston. The south of Houston has William P. Hobby Airport.
